Now, here's the thing; My AxeFXII is permanently connected to my Win10 desktop so I can record whenever I want without much hassle. A week ago I realised I haven't upgraded the firmware in months so I did that and I also installed the latest version of the AxeEdit.
A few days ago I noticed that most of the times I was firing up AxeEdit, it reported that the AxeFx was disconnected. After a quick investigation I saw that even the USB bootloader was reporting that the AxeFX was disconnected.
Unfortunately, the only solution I've come up with when this happens is to uninstall and reinstall the FAS driver. Yesterday that alone didn't work so I had to manually remove some AxeFX entries in the Device Manager, restart the PC, reinstall the drivers etc.
Has anyone come across this issue?
